Focal Point is this intriguing little drama from 2009 that plays with the concept of love and perception. The story centers around an old photographer who possesses this almost mythical camera that can reveal the truth about relationships. The atmosphere is quite melancholic, with a slow pacing that allows you to really soak in the emotional weight of each moment. The practical effects are understated, but they complement the narrative nicely, enhancing that surreal quality without overshadowing the performances. The lead, though unknown, brings a certain weight to the character, embodying doubt and curiosity about his own craft. It's a film that lingers in your mind, raising questions about the nature of love and the risks we take in seeking the truth. Definitely a conversation starter among collectors.
